Ghost of Yotei Music from Watanabe Mode Out Now

By Josh PiedraOctober 3, 2025
ghost-of-yotei-header-image

Milan Records today releases GHOST OF YŌTEI – MUSIC FROM WATANABE MODE, an EP of music directed by Cowboy Bebop and Samurai Champloo director SHINICHIRŌ WATANABE for the PlayStation®5 video game.

Ghost of Yotei

Available everywhere now, the album includes six original lo-fi, beat-driven tracks produced by the iconic anime director for the game’s “Watanabe Mode,” one of three gameplay modes included within the open world action-adventure video game. An ode to the hip hop-tinged beats popularized by Samurai Champloo, Watanabe Mode delivers a downtempo musical backdrop as players journey through 1600s Japan.

Today’s release follows the debut of the game’s Original Soundtrack by composer Toma Otowa, whose 22-track score fuses authentic Japanese sounds with American Western colors to heighten the drama with themes that are both intimate and epic.

TRACKLISTING –

  1. Yotei Six Theme (DJ Mitsu the Beats Remix) –DJ Mitsu the Beats & Toma Otowa
  2. 1st Refrain – Sweet William
  3. Kiseki – mabanua
  4. Rei and Retribution – Mark de Clive-Lowe
  5. Kasumi – Sweet William
  6. Atsu’s Theme (Sweet William Remix) – Sweet William & Toma Otowa
